Care & Maintenance Tips

  • Wipe the Damascus blade clean and dry after each use.

  • Apply a light coat of knife oil regularly to help protect the steel.

  • Avoid prolonged exposure to moisture or humid conditions.

  • Store the knife in a cool, dry place when not in use.

  • Do not leave the knife inside the leather sheath for long-term storage.

  • Use a quality sharpening stone to maintain the blade edge carefully.

What is pakkawood?

Pakkawood is a durable engineered wood material valued for its strength, moisture resistance, and polished appearance, making it ideal for knife handles.
